Problem
Existing analyte monitoring systems do not effectively encourage users to interact with them at a frequency that maximizes their benefits, leading to increased risks of hyperglycemic or hypoglycemic episodes.
Innovation Solution
A system that monitors user interaction frequency, compares it to predetermined targets, and alerts users when interaction falls below these targets, with adjustable levels based on user history, activity, and analyte levels, and includes rewards and alarms to encourage consistent engagement.
Engineering Contradictions & Design Principles
Engineering Contradiction Analysis
1Reliability
If continuous glucose monitoring is provided with frequent analyte level availability, then patients can derive maximum benefit from the system, but patients may not interact with the system frequently enough to realize these benefits
Solution Approach 1:
The system monitors user interaction frequency with the glucose monitoring system and provides feedback by comparing actual interaction to target interaction levels. When interaction falls below the target, the system generates an alert to encourage the user to increase their engagement with the device, thereby ensuring they realize the full benefits of continuous monitoring.
2Ease of operation
If manual periodic glucose testing is used, then the system is simple to operate, but consistency of testing varies widely among individuals
Solution Approach 1:
The system tracks how many times the user has performed manual glucose testing and compares this to a target frequency. When the user fails to test consistently, the system provides feedback through alerts and notifications, encouraging them to maintain regular testing schedules and improve consistency without adding operational complexity.
